Understanding the Sand Mole Crab
The Sand Mole Crab, scientifically known as Emerita analoga, is a small crustacean that burrows into the sand along the shoreline. These crabs are often found in the intertidal zone, where they spend most of their time buried in the sand with only their antennae and eyes visible. Their unique adaptation allows them to filter feed on organic matter and plankton that wash up with the waves.
Habitat and Distribution
The Sand Mole Crab is commonly found in sandy beaches and shallow waters along the coasts of the Pacific Ocean. They prefer areas with fine, well-sorted sand where they can easily burrow and hide from predators. These crabs are particularly abundant in regions with strong wave action, as this helps to bring food particles to their burrows.

Physical Characteristics
The Sand Mole Crab has a distinctive appearance that sets it apart from other crustaceans. Their body is segmented and covered in a hard exoskeleton, which provides protection and support. The most notable feature of the Sand Mole Crab is its long, segmented antennae, which are used for sensing the environment and detecting food particles.
Key physical characteristics of the Sand Mole Crab include:
- Segmented body covered in a hard exoskeleton
- Long, segmented antennae for sensing
- Small size, typically ranging from 1 to 2 inches in length
- Burrowing behavior, with only antennae and eyes visible above the sand
Behavior and Feeding Habits
The Sand Mole Crab is primarily a filter feeder, using its antennae to capture organic matter and plankton from the water. They burrow into the sand and wait for the waves to bring food particles to their burrows. This behavior allows them to conserve energy while still obtaining the necessary nutrients.

Ecological Importance
The Sand Mole Crab plays a vital role in the marine ecosystem by helping to recycle nutrients and maintain the health of sandy beaches. Their burrowing behavior aerates the sand, which improves oxygen flow and supports the growth of other organisms. Additionally, their filter-feeding habits help to remove excess organic matter from the water, contributing to water quality.

Conservation Status
The Sand Mole Crab is not currently listed as endangered, but like many marine species, it faces threats from habitat destruction and pollution. Human activities such as beach development, pollution, and climate change can negatively impact the habitats of these crabs, making conservation efforts crucial for their long-term survival.
